Clay Nanoparticles Market Size

The global Clay Nanoparticles market was valued at US$ 483 million in 2025 and is anticipated to reach US$ 624 million by 2032, at a CAGR of 3.8% from 2026 to 2032.

Nanoclays are nanoparticles of layered mineral silicates, which present an anisotropic plate-like structures about 1 nm thick and 100 nm in diameter. The main types of clay nanoparticles incorporated into hydrogel nanocomposites include montmorillonite (MMT), bentonite, and other silicate clays.
Global production of clay nanoparticles is projected to reach 110,000 tons in 2025, with an average price of $4.4 per kg.
Upstream of clay nanoparticles mainly consists of natural layered silicate minerals such as montmorillonite, kaolin, and bentonite, along with chemical modifiers, surface organic agents, and materials for milling and classification. Downstream applications define market value and structure, with key uses in polymers and composites to enhance barrier properties, mechanical strength, and thermal resistance, widely applied in packaging films, automotive plastics, and engineering plastics. They are also used in coatings and inks for rheology control, anti-settling, and film densification, in rubber, sealants, and construction materials to improve durability, in pharmaceuticals and cosmetics for controlled release and structural stabilization, and in environmental applications for adsorption of heavy metals and organic pollutants. Downstream users focus on dispersion stability, degree of exfoliation, batch consistency, and formulation compatibility.
Industry trends are moving toward higher purity, controlled particle size, surface functionalization, and environmentally friendly modification. Demand from high-performance materials and sustainable packaging is the primary growth driver, supported by lightweight design and material reduction trends. Stricter environmental regulations further promote adoption in water-based systems and environmental remediation. Key restraints include limited access to high-quality raw minerals, technical challenges in nano-scale exfoliation and stable dispersion, higher costs for consistency in large-scale production, and cautious regulatory evaluation in sensitive application fields.
In terms of profitability, clay nanoparticles generally show moderate gross margins. Basic and lightly modified products typically achieve margins of 25%–40%, while high-purity, highly exfoliated, or surface-functionalized products can reach 40%–60%. Gross margins mainly depend on raw material quality, modification and dispersion technology, degree of product differentiation, and penetration into high-end composite and functional applications.
